Cost of Commercial Water Removal in Burlington, NC
The cost of commercial water removal can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Burlington, NC.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of surface, bacterial presence |
| Monitoring and Follow-up | $100 – $500 | Frequency of visits, size of affected area, complexity of issue |
| Equipment Rental or Buy | $500 – $5,000 | Type and quality of equipment, rental period, buy vs. Rental |
| Disposal and Debris Removal | $200 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of debris, disposal methods |
